  2. It was fun! They did police dog agility (which was similar to ‘regular’ agility, but more intense). The dog AND handler both had to do a ‘down’ on the field! I’d like to see the AKC make that a requirement for future trials!

    They also did the ‘fastest dog’ competition which was really great to watch. The dogs were at one end of the field and a pseudo-bad-guy was at the other end. The handler would release the dog and let them ‘attack’ the bad guy. The dogs LOVED it! I can’t imagine what it must feel like to be hit by a 60+ pound GSD running at 30+ miles per hour!

    All the dogs at this competition were GSD’s imported from Czechoslovakia.
